Read-only. Operational in hours, not months.
Grant read-only access and AI Pulse does the rest — no agents in your workloads, no data pipelines to maintain, nothing to migrate.
Discover
Connect via Azure Managed Identity — read-only, no stored credentials. AI Pulse scans your estate for AI services, agents and models, including the shadow AI no one registered.
Assess
Every system is risk-tiered — exposure, ownership, data sensitivity and behaviour — so leadership can see which AI is governed, which is exposed, and which needs action.
Map once
Map each system a single time and report it against many frameworks — EU AI Act, ISO 42001, NIST AI RMF, MAS TRM and more. No re-work per regulation.
Evidence
Control state and provenance are collected continuously, producing audit-ready evidence you can put in front of a board or a regulator — not a screenshot scramble the week before an audit.
Remediate
Gaps become prioritised, owned actions — carried out in your own Azure, ITSM and DevOps tools. AI Pulse observes and directs; it never writes to your environment.
Governance is only as good as the numbers behind it.
Every figure in AI Pulse carries its origin. A number is Live when it comes straight from your cloud, Derived when it is calculated, an Assumption when it rests on a configured input, and Not Assessed when the source simply isn't connected yet. AI Pulse never invents a value to fill a gap or paints a dashboard green to look reassuring — the gaps are the point, because they tell you exactly what to connect or assess next.

Deployed where your data lives. Read-only by design.
AI Pulse runs inside your own Azure tenant and observes your estate through read-only permissions. It holds zero write access, stores no credentials, and no AI asset data, telemetry or evidence leaves your cloud boundary.
Azure-native
Runs as a Container App in your subscription, authenticating with Managed Identity — no secrets, no service principals, least-privilege read-only scopes.
